The Manotom plant ended 2023 with a loss of 40.4 million rubles

The company’s turnover increased by almost 20%.

Photo source: Manotom plant website

According to the Interfax agency, the revenue of Manotom OJSC at the end of 2023 amounted to 901.4 million rubles (+19% compared to 2022), while the company’s net loss increased 6.5 times (to 40.4 million rubles).

It is noted that in the structure of turnover, income from the sale of products of own production amounted to 860.4 million rubles (+19.4%), from the sale of purchased goods – 41 million rubles (+9.2%).

The company’s accounts payable increased from 288.5 million rubles as of December 31, 2022 to 342 million rubles as of December 31, 2023, while accounts receivable decreased from 76.9 million rubles to 64.5 million rubles.

“According to the explanatory note to the financial statements, by the end of 2024 Manotom expects to break even due to the expansion of the sales market and the promotion of new products,” – stated in the agency’s material.
